In 1976 Elizabeth McRae went missing from Coombesbury Woods in the Northern area of what is now the National Diving & Activity Centre.

Elizabeth was a rare dog breeder from London who was to marry a local Lord.

Coombesbury Woods
Coombesbury Woods, the site of several disappearances and subject of Chepstow folklore

Her vanity had led her to use Tintern Abbey as the wedding venue, with the reception taking place at a clearing in Coombesbury Woods. The spectacular reception was to be held in a gigantic Big Top tent, holding 400 people and featuring a travelling Circus.

FearFest-Evil is a live Halloween horror event running for selected nights in October, from Friday the 13th until Halloween night. (Full List of Dates») The immersive and interactive horror event includes the ‘Trilogy of Horrors‘ spread over a disused limestone quarry, historic railway line and surrounding haunted woodland near Chepstow. Each area has multiple scare zones with monsters, night creatures and lots of terrifying surprises! For the adrenalin junkies we’ve the G forces of the Hangman’s Swing – a terrifying attraction 245 feet in the air or the 700m long Death Slide over the cold waters of our 80m deep quarry.
